CVE-2022-49966: drm/amd/pm: add missing ->fini_microcode interface for Sienna Cichlid

In the Linux kernel, the following vulnerability has been resolved: drm/amd/pm: add missing ->fini_microcode interface for Sienna Cichlid To avoid any potential memory leak.

Plain-English summary

This CVE covers a Linux kernel AMD graphics power-management cleanup issue. A missing microcode finalization interface for Sienna Cichlid could cause a potential memory leak. The public record does not provide CVSS, confirmed impact beyond leakage risk, or evidence of active exploitation.

Executive priority

Treat as routine kernel hygiene unless your estate has affected AMDGPU systems or vendor advisories raise severity. There is no sourced evidence here of exploitation or urgent internet-scale abuse, but kernel memory-management flaws should still be closed through standard patch cycles.

Technical view

The Linux kernel AMD DRM power-management code lacked a ->fini_microcode interface for Sienna Cichlid. Upstream stable commits resolve the issue to avoid a potential memory leak. The CVE record lists affected Linux kernel versions but does not describe privilege requirements, trigger conditions, or security boundary impact.

Likely exposure

Exposure appears limited to Linux kernels containing the affected AMD DRM/PM Sienna Cichlid code path. Organizations should prioritize systems with AMDGPU hardware and kernel versions identified in the CVE record, while confirming exact package status with their Linux distributor.

Exploitation context

The provided sources do not show KEV listing, active exploitation, public exploit availability, or weaponized use. Because the record only states a potential memory leak, operational risk depends on whether the affected driver path is present and reachable in deployed systems.

Researcher notes

The available record is sparse: no CVSS, CWE, exploitability detail, or trigger path is provided. Analysis should focus on commit diff review, vendor backport mapping, and whether the affected AMDGPU code path is compiled and used in target kernels.
